Wells Fargo Business Elite Signature Card vs Wells Fargo Signify Business Cash

Both are business travel cards. The Wells Fargo Business Elite Signature Card comes from Wells Fargo at $125/yr; the Wells Fargo Signify Business Cash from Wells Fargo at $0/yr. Below: side-by-side specs, an opinionated verdict, and the FAQs people actually ask before applying.

Bottom line

Both cards come from Wells Fargo and target business spenders, so the choice usually comes down to whether you'll use the premium-tier benefits. The Wells Fargo Business Elite Signature Card costs $125 more per year, only worth it if you'll actually use the upgraded perks.
